    So with Ireland, the South is the Republic of Ireland and it is an independent nation. Northern Ireland is still part of the UK. The reason for the partition of the Island is that there was a greater proportion of Protestants (who were the over all minority) in the North East of the Island. Before the Irish war of independence the Protestant minority were the ruling class on the Island and for centuries had discriminated against Catholics. They opposed Irish independence for economic reasons but also because they feared being discriminated against if the Catholic majority took power. After the island was partitioned, Northern Ireland became a country within the UK with a protestant majority. They continued to discriminate against and disenfranchise Catholics. This gave rise to a Catholic civil rights movement in the 1960's inspired by Martin Luther King's activism. The government's violent response to the Civil Rights marches and demonstrations, along with attacks on Catholic neighbourhoods by Protestant paramilitary groups lead to a resurgence of the IRA. This in turn kicked off a 40 year period of tit for tat murders and terrorist attacks between Catholic and Protestant paramilitary groups known as the troubles.

    She left out Russia, Lol!
    Even though most of the country is in Asia, Russia is still part of Europe from the west of the Ural mountains.
    For anyone who is curious to know more; it's been said by many historians, researchers, and perhaps geographers that around 700 BC, the 3 continents (Africa, Asia, and Europe) were separated by Greeks and one of the geographical landmarks they use to separate the continents was the Ural Mountains located within the country of Russia. Therefore Russia is both a country of Europe and Asia.
    Random fact: most of the Russian land is in the land of Asia while most of its population is in the land of Europe along with the two large and famous cities, Moscow and St. Petersburg

    Indeed, there is a lot of contention about Macedonia! The historical kingdom of Macedon (of Alexander The Great fame) was located roughly in regions now part of northern Greece and North Macedonia. Despite the fact that the Greek city states were conquered by Macedon, modern Greeks proudly lay claim to the legacy of Alexander and his kingdom, while people who do not consider themselves "Greek" and yet live in lands of historical Macedon too have their own connections...hence the issue! The many modern (think the past couple of centuries) contentions in the Balkan region, often arising from powerful European nations imposing state borders in multi-ethnic regions in the period since the end of WWI, are why the term Balkanization came into being.
    P.S. The conquering kingdom of Macedon was what became the "empire, not "Greece" itself. The individual city states of Greece had a notion of shared civilization but otherwise were quite separate (until conquered, of course!).

    Yeah, some places from Sardinia are considered "blue zones" which is populations of people with very high life expectancy and high quality of life. Okinawans also are there, as are a couple more demographics, like the US Seventh Day Adventists (which tbh is mostly a cult lmao but they do have very healthy living habits...). The things they share in common is daily moderate exercise (gardening for hours, for example), rich cultural and social lives spending time in person with each other, and diets that are almost completely vegetarian with lots of legumes (beans, chickpeas, lentils, peas, tofu...) and greens and olive oil instead of butter and what not. Basically: sleep well, eat your veggies, do exercise, and don't forget to spend quality time with your family and friends
